Metalist 1925 Kharkiv 0-2 BSC Young Boys: Essende and Fernandes seal first pre-season win in Jenbach

BSC Young Boys secured their first victory of the 2026/27 pre-season campaign with a composed 2-0 win over Ukrainian side Metalist 1925 Kharkiv in Jenbach, Austria on Sunday. Two first-half goals — Samuel Essende's 28th-minute strike and Edimilson Fernandes's stoppage-time finish — decided the contest.

Young Boys dominated possession and created the better chances throughout the 90 minutes at their Austrian training camp base. The result marked a step forward for Gerardo Seoane's side after three winless pre-season outings.

How it unfolded

YB took the lead in the 28th minute through a well-worked set piece. Joël Sanches delivered a corner into the box, Lewin Blum flicked on with a header, and Samuel Essende was on hand to convert from close range.

Essende, the 26-year-old French striker who joined YB in January 2026, opened his pre-season account with a poacher's finish.

Young Boys doubled their lead in first-half stoppage time (45+1). Allan Virginius and Gregory Lauper combined to set up Edimilson Fernandes, who swept the ball home from inside the box to make it 2-0 at the break.

The turning point

Fernandes's goal in first-half added time effectively killed the contest. Kharkiv had absorbed pressure well after Essende's opener, but conceding a second just before the interval left the Ukrainian side with a mountain to climb. YB's defensive structure — marshalled by captain Loris Benito in the first half and Cédric Zesiger after the interval — ensured Kharkiv never threatened a comeback.

Key performers

  • Samuel Essende (YB): Scored the opening goal and led the line effectively for 62 minutes before being substituted. His movement and hold-up play caused problems for the Kharkiv defence.
  • Joël Mall (YB): Kept a clean sheet in his 62 minutes between the posts, making one routine save. Featured in the official YB match day interview.
  • Edimilson Fernandes (YB): Capped a strong midfield display with the second goal in first-half stoppage time. Played 46 minutes before being replaced.
  • Cédric Zesiger (YB): The returning centre-back played the second half after replacing Benito at the interval, helping YB see out the clean sheet in his first appearance since re-joining the club.

Player of the Match: Samuel Essende — match-winning goal and a physical presence up front.

What it means

Young Boys' first pre-season win comes after draws against LASK (0-0, 10 January 2026) and Solothurn, providing a confidence boost ahead of their next test against German Bundesliga side Bayer Leverkusen on 10 July 2026. Metalist 1925 Kharkiv, preparing for the new Ukrainian Premier League season, have now played two pre-season friendlies: a 6-2 win over Qarabag (1 July) and this defeat.
